#28db34 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#28db34 is composed of 15.7% red, 85.9%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 76.3%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 124 degrees, a saturation of 71.3% and a lightness of 50.8%. #28db34 color hex could be obtained by blending #50ff68 with #00b700.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

#28db34 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#28db34 has RGB values of R:40, G:219, B:52 and CMYK values of C:0.82, M:0, Y:0.76,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 2677556.

Shades and Tints of #28db34
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010301 is the darkest color, while #f2fdf2 is the lightest one.
